File content as of revision 0:c2319e0e250e:
#include"mbed.h"
Serial device(p28,p27);//tx:left rx:right
Serial pc(USBTX, USBRX);//pcとの通信設定
DigitalOut REDE(LED1);
int data[2]={7,1};
//通信設定
void init(void){
device.baud(115200);
pc.baud(115200);
REDE = 0;
}
//ID書き換え
void IDchange(unsigned char ID, unsigned char data){
unsigned char Txdata[9]; //bytedata[9byte]
unsigned char CheckSum = 0;
Txdata[0] = 0xFA; //Header
Txdata[1] = 0xAF; //Header
Txdata[2] = ID; //ID
Txdata[3] = 0x00; //Flags
Txdata[4] = 0x04; //Adress
Txdata[5] = 0x01; //Length
Txdata[6] = 0x01; //Count
Txdata[7] = data; //data
for(int i=2; i<=7; i++){
CheckSum = CheckSum ^ Txdata[i];
}
Txdata[8] = CheckSum;
//Send Packet
REDE = 1;
for (int i=0; i<=8; i++){
device.putc(Txdata[i]);
pc.putc(Txdata[i]);
}
wait_us(250);
REDE = 0;
}
//データの書き込み
void WriteROM(unsigned char ID){
unsigned char Txdata[8]; //bytedata[8byte]
unsigned char CheckSum = 0;
Txdata[0] = 0xFA; //Header
Txdata[1] = 0xAF; //Header
Txdata[2] = ID; //ID
Txdata[3] = 0x40; //Flags
Txdata[4] = 0xFF; //Adress
Txdata[5] = 0x00; //Length
Txdata[6] = 0x00; //Count
for(int i=2; i<=6; i++){
CheckSum = CheckSum ^ Txdata[i];
}
Txdata[7] = CheckSum;
//Send Packet
REDE = 1;
for (int i=0; i<=7; i++){
device.putc(Txdata[i]);
pc.putc(Txdata[i]);
}
wait_us(250);
REDE = 0;
}
//PCから割り込み時のデータ受け取り
void getdata(){
for(int i=0;i<=1;i++){
data[i] = pc.getc();
}
IDchange(data[0],data[1]);
WriteROM(data[1]);
}
//トルク出力
void torque(unsigned char ID, unsigned char data){
unsigned char TxData[9]; //bytedata[9byte]
unsigned char CheckSum = 0; //CheckSum cakcukation
TxData[0] = 0xFA; //Header
TxData[1] = 0xAF; //Header
TxData[2] = ID; //ID
TxData[3] = 0x00; //Flags
TxData[4] = 0x24; //Adress
TxData[5] = 0x01; //Length
TxData[6] = 0x01; //Count
TxData[7] = data; //data
//CheckSum calculation
for(int i=2; i<=7; i++){
CheckSum = CheckSum ^ TxData[i];
}
TxData[8] = CheckSum;
//Send Packet
REDE = 1;
for (int i=0; i<=8; i++){
device.putc(TxData[i]);
// pc.putc(TxData[i]);
}
wait_us(250);
REDE = 0;
}
//ゴールポジション
void GoalPosition (unsigned char ID, int data){
unsigned char TxData[10];//10bytedata
unsigned char CheckSum = 0;
TxData[0] = 0xFA; //Header
TxData[1] = 0xAF; //Header
TxData[2] = ID; //ID
TxData[3] = 0x00; //Flags
TxData[4] = 0x1E; //Adress
TxData[5] = 0x02; //Length
TxData[6] = 0x01; //Count
TxData[7] = (unsigned char)0x00FF & data;
TxData[8] = (unsigned char)0x00FF & (data >> 8);
//CheckSum calculation
for(int i=2; i<=8; i++){
CheckSum = CheckSum ^ TxData[i];
}
TxData[9] = CheckSum;
//Send Packet
REDE = 1;
for (int i=0; i<=9; i++){
device.putc(TxData[i]);
pc.putc(TxData[i]);
}
wait_us(250);
REDE = 0;
}
int main(){
init();
// pc.attach(getdata, Serial::RxIrq);
while(1){REDE = 1;
IDchange(data[0],data[1]);
WriteROM(data[1]);
torque(data[1],0x01);
wait(0.5);
GoalPosition(data[1],1500);
wait(2);
GoalPosition(data[1],-15000);
wait(2);
}
}
